Google withdrew its new AI image-generation feature for Google Earth one day after its rollout [1].

The removal follows the discovery that users employed the tool to create realistic but fake satellite images. These fabrications included simulated war zones and nuclear facilities, raising immediate alarms about the potential for digital deception on a global scale.

Google Earth provides global satellite, aerial, and 3D imagery. By integrating generative AI, the platform allowed users to modify or create visual data that appeared authentic. However, the speed with which the tool was misused to simulate high-conflict areas prompted the company to pull the feature [1], [2].

Concerns centered on the tool's ability to spread misinformation. Because Google Earth is often viewed as a definitive source of geographical truth, the ability to fabricate evidence of military activity or nuclear infrastructure poses a risk to international security and public perception [2].

The company acted to prevent the tool from being used as a weapon for disinformation. The rapid withdrawal suggests a failure in the initial safety guardrails intended to prevent the generation of sensitive or deceptive geopolitical content [1].

Google has not provided a timeline for when, or if, a modified version of the tool will return. The incident highlights the ongoing struggle for tech companies to balance creative AI capabilities with the need to verify factual accuracy in mapping software [1], [2].

This incident underscores the volatility of integrating generative AI into tools traditionally used for factual verification. When AI can convincingly simulate satellite imagery, it erodes the reliability of open-source intelligence (OSINT), making it harder for the public and analysts to distinguish between real-world events and digitally manufactured evidence.
